Output d3e8cf3ec03f768298f69092b925e975f036e8fb2a708f5f8fcbbe340d47ac6e:11

value
1003897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4afc35e0ce77b4ed1b86e017cd526383f24e83fb OP_EQUAL
address
38XW4dTAvJ1i6mePKDH4Ja6c4fN8vjCVhA
transaction
d3e8cf3ec03f768298f69092b925e975f036e8fb2a708f5f8fcbbe340d47ac6e
spent
false